ASM #651

This issue actually fell a little flat. While it's nice to have Hobby "back," this version's cliched villain puns and actions don't shock-and-awe as Slott intended. While Ramos' art looks good, a lot of the action panels seem rushed and don't do much other than depect trembling, firing buildings Spidey has to escape. Been there, done that. While the focus on this battle and Kingpin's Shadowland is a nice change in pace from the previous overplotting, it also comes off as the least interesting. At least the next Spider-Slayer arc appears like nothing Pete's had to deal with lately.

3/5

ASM #652

I wasn't sure about this whole damn Spider-Slayer thing, but wow was it ever-entertaining. Slott also has a great handle on all of the family of characters, no doubt about that. While Casselli's art didn't live up to his work on Secret Warriors, it's a strong fit for the wacked-out premise; likewise with Reilly Brown's work on FVL's humorous little back-up. After an only decent issue last week, Slott once again proves he's the right man for the web-slinging job.

4/5
